Learning outcomes

The student is able to:
- critically analyze and evaluate corporate responsibility and sustainable development in companies and organizations
- implement ethical, social and environmental aspects into the company strategic decision-making and into practice
- resolve complex social and environmental business matters
- professionally communicate CSR issues to stakeholders and the public

Assessment criteria

Evaluation consists of self evaluation, peer evaluation and evaluation of the teacher. Company cases and/or the project will also be evaluated by the comissioner(s).

Assessment scale

1-5

Assessment criteria: level 1 (assessment scale 1–5)

The student
- shows ability to describe ethical and environmental performance of companies and organisations
-- participates in discussions on given topics
- is able to deliver the given assignments on time

Assessment criteria: level 3 (assessment scale 1–5)

The student
- shows ability to evaluate ethical and environmental performance of companies and organisations
- understands the multitude of CSR
- discusses the given topics and gives independent and critical arguments
- gives concrete recommendations for companies to improve their environmental or social performance

Assessment criteria: level 5 (assessment scale 1–5)

The student
- shows ability to critically analyze ethical and environmental performance of companies and organisations
- discusses the given topics on a professional level
- can validate his arguments coherently
- gives concrete, realistic and innovative recommendations for companies to improve their environmental or social performance
